SLS prototyping processing principle
SLS is the abbreviation of selective laser sintering. The selective laser sintering process principle
is contour of prototype which need to be processed into each layer, along the CAD path, the laser scan
on each layer of PA powder, the illuminated powder melt into solid liquid, layer by layer accumulated to
form the outline of the prototype. Then the table cooling after the machine stopped, and the liquid cooled
molding.

What’s the difference between SLS and SLA?
First ,the processing material is different, SLS sintering adopt PA powder to process, whereas SLA adopt
photosensitive resin.
Second, SLS prototype can resist high temperature and impact power, and the strength is good. But SLA prototypeis easy to deform when the temperature over 60 degree celsius, and the strength is poor, easy
to break.The only bad thing is the surface post-processing treatment of SLS is less convenient than SLA
